À propos de ce/cette Ginger

Ginger is grown and harvesting from a farm in Guys Hill St Catherine a parish in the middle of Jamaica. It is harvested and transported to a packaging house where it is washed and dried. The next day it is transported to the courier for export transportation. 

 

Ginger is the dried knobby shaped rhizome of the plant which is grown underground. Ginger is classified as a rhizome (underground stem), which is primarily used in the food and pharmaceutical industries. The rhizome contains up to 64% starch with essential oils and fats, and a little sugar. Ginger will be placed in a carton boxes and will be shipped on that day or the following. Shipping time is schedule to reach four to five business days from departure.

 

Fresh ginger is brown on the outside and slightly yellow on the inside. Within a cool environment the freshness can last for several days to weeks. Its season is all year round.
